Update Info - Canterbury Tea Room
This restaurant was reported as closed. If it is open, let us know.
Canterbury Tea Room
1229 10th Ave
Greeley, CO 80631
1229 10th Ave
Greeley, CO 80631
This restaurant was reported as closed. If it is open, let us know.